The Amp in the trunk might have blown,
Town Car Radio Wire Diagram
Car Radio Battery Constant 12v+ Wire: Pink/Light Blue
Car Radio Accessory Switched 12v+ Wire: Yellow/Black
Car Radio Ground Wire: Black/Light Green
Car Radio Illumination Wire: Light Blue/Red
Car Stereo Dimmer Wire: Blue/Red
Car Stereo Antenna Trigger Wire: Blue
Car Stereo Amplifier Location: Trunk

Car Audio Front Speakers Location: Doors
Left Front Speaker Positive Wire (+): Orange/Light Green
Left Front Speaker Negative Wire (-): Light Blue/White
Right Front Speaker Positive Wire (+): White/Light Green
Right Front Speaker Negative Wire (-): Dark Green/Orange

Car Audio Rear Speakers Location: Rear Deck
Left Rear Speaker Positive Wire (+): Gray/Light Blue
Left Rear Speaker Negative Wire (-): Tan/Yellow
Right Rear Speaker Positive Wire (+): Orange/Red
Right Rear Speaker Negative Wire (-): Brown/Pink
Check the fuses

My radio in my 1995 lincoln towncar comes on but no sound comes out of it, please tell me how to fix this what's wrong

Your 1995 Town Car has a separate power amp, located in the trunk behind the rear seat back on the passenger side. It has a fuse in it. Replace that.
